About Fire & Stone Spitalfields

Fire and Stone restaurant in Spitalfields brings a new and exciting dining experience to the heart of Old Spitalfields Market.

We offer unique pizzas, pastas and salads inspired by the unusual flavours of the world using the freshest ingredients carefully prepared on-site everyday. Spitalfields is open for lunch and dinner 7 days a week, with room for up to 190 people.

Take a table on the front terrace and soak in the atmosphere of the busy market while keeping your eyes open for style conscious celebrities doing a spot of bargain hunting!
